UK FCDO Travel Advisory – Turkey – Updated May 2026 (Against All Travel to Syria Border Zone)

The UK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O) updated its travel advisory for Turkey on 8 May 2026, maintaining its advice against all travel to within 10km of the Turkey-Syria border due to ongoing fighting and heightened terrorism risk. The update includes revised information on Ramadan, terrorism, and children and accommodation under the Safety and Security section. Regional escalation is flagged as posing significant security risks and causing travel disruption. British nationals are advised to monitor media, keep departure plans under review, and ensure travel documents are up to date.

Low impact. LOW: Fourth-pass historical recalibration. This is a travel/security/advisory update rather than a discrete London Market loss event. It may be useful background context, but the available reporting does not evidence a current insured-loss pathway such as named insured asset damage, vessel/cargo loss, port/airspace/waterway closure, energy/facility outage, claims/loss estimate, sanctions asset action, reinsurance impact, or market pricing/capacity response.
